Yohaan Fernandes
About
Yohaan Fernandes has authored 18 papers that have received a total of 686 indexed citations.
This includes 15 papers in Cell Biology, 10 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and 5 papers in Molecular Biology. The topics of these papers are Zebrafish Biomedical Research Applications (15 papers), Prenatal Substance Exposure Effects (10 papers) and Birth, Development, and Health (9 papers). Yohaan Fernandes is often cited by papers focused on Zebrafish Biomedical Research Applications (15 papers), Prenatal Substance Exposure Effects (10 papers) and Birth, Development, and Health (9 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Brazil. Yohaan Fernandes's co-authors include Robert Gerlai, Mindy Rampersad, Johann K. Eberhart, C. Ben Lovely and Kenneth A. Johnson and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Behavioural Brain Research and Alcoholism Clinical and Experimental Research.
